What's Happening?
Shayne Gostisbehere has been a standout player for the Carolina Hurricanes in the Stanley Cup Final against the Vegas Golden Knights. In Game 2, Gostisbehere assisted on a crucial power-play goal in overtime, helping the Hurricanes secure a 4-3 victory
and even the series at 1-1. His performance has been pivotal, showcasing his offensive talents and strategic playmaking abilities.
